Root T-mobile branded rooting process

I'm looking to root my desire HD. It's currently on the latest broken T-mobile build 1.84.

I'm toying with the idea of going over to android revolution mod. Can you guys in the know confirm I've got the process right?

1. Make goldcard
2. Downgrade to a 1.32 build
3. Root
4. Install clockwork etc..
5. Flash my new rom of choice.

If I want to go back to stock
6. Run the t-mobile 1.72 RUU.

Does that all sound right?

Thanks :)

I recently did this process (as I had a branded Orange UK mobile) - the above is all correct... as part of the root process, you'll also need to get Radio S-Off... not difficult at all, as there's a one click program that does it for you.

The thing that took me a long time was the goldcard part... once I'd sorted that, the root process was painless! :D
